Hans Delbrück

Hans Delbrück (November 11, 1848 - July 14, 1929), German historian, was born at Bergen on the island of Rügen, and studied at the universities of Heidelberg and Bonn.

As a soldier he fought in the Franco-German War, after which he was for some years tutor to one of the princes of the German imperial family. In 1885 he became professor of modern history in the university of Berlin, and he was a member of the German Reichstag from 1884 to 1890.

Delbrück's writings are chiefly concerned with the history of the art of war, his most ambitious work being his Geschichte der Kriegskunst im Rahmen der politischen Geschichte (first section, Das Altertum, 1900; second, Römer und Germanen, 1902; third, Das Mittelalter, 1907). Among his other works are:

  • Die Perserkriege und die Burgunderkriege (Berlin, 1887)
  • Historische und politische Aufsätze (1886)
  • Erinnerungen, Aufsätze und Reden (1902)
  • Die Strategie des Perikles erläutert durch die Strategie Friedrichs des Grossen (1890)
  • Die Polenfrage (1894)
  • Das Leben des Feldmarschalls Grafen Neithardt von Gneisenau (1882 and 1894).

Delbrück began in 1883 to edit the Preussische Jahrbucher, in which he wrote many articles, including one on General Wolseley über Napoleon, Wellington und Gneisenau, and he has contributed to the Europäischer Geschichtskalender of H Schulthess.
